A POS system is a crucial tool for hotels as it helps manage and track sales transactions, inventory, and customer information On the other hand, a PMS system is essential for managing reservations, room assignments, guest profiles, and billing By integrating the POS system with the PMS, hotels can eliminate the need for manual data entry and reduce the risk of errors This integration allows for real-time communication between the two systems, ensuring that all departments are on the same page.
One of the key benefits of POS and Hotel PMS integration is the ability to provide a personalized experience for guests With a seamless integration, hotels can access guest information such as preferences, past purchases, and special requests from the PMS system directly at the POS terminal This allows staff to tailor their service to meet the individual needs of each guest, resulting in a more memorable and enjoyable stay.
In addition to enhancing guest experiences, POS and Hotel PMS integration can also help streamline operations and improve efficiency By automating the transfer of data between the two systems, hotels can reduce the amount of time spent on manual tasks such as reconciling sales records and updating inventory This not only frees up staff to focus on other tasks but also minimizes the risk of errors that can occur with manual data entry.

By sharing real-time data, the front desk can easily access information about restaurant and bar purchases, while the F&B staff can view guest room charges This allows for better coordination between departments, leading to faster service and a more seamless guest experience.
Furthermore, POS and Hotel PMS integration can help hotels track customer preferences and spending habits more effectively By analyzing data from both systems, hotels can identify trends, anticipate guest needs, and tailor their offerings accordingly This information can be used to create targeted marketing campaigns, loyalty programs, and promotions that resonate with guests and drive revenue.
From a financial perspective, POS and Hotel PMS integration can also lead to cost savings for hotels By eliminating the need for duplicate data entry and reducing errors, hotels can improve accuracy in reporting and forecasting, leading to better decision-making Additionally, by streamlining operations and improving efficiency, hotels can reduce labor costs and optimize resources.
